Good Morning America to Feature RV Lifestyle Segment

Originally Published in Trailer Life Magazine

A feature segment about a family’s first-ever trip in an RV to avoid worries associated
with air travel will begin Monday, November 19, 2001, on ABC’s Good Morning America,
according to Gary LaBella, spokesman for the Recreation Vehicle Industry Association
(RVIA), Reston, Virginia. Airing on Monday through Thanksgiving morning, November 22, the
subject of the feature will be a 750-mile trip from Florida to Illinois by Henry and Gail
Davidson and their daughters, ages 12 and 22. Good Morning America will chronicle their
trip each day as they make their way to Thanksgiving dinner with relatives, including a
90-year-old aunt. Good Morning America is broadcast in most markets from 7 a.m. to 9 a.m.
